In unserem vorherigen Artikel haben wir gelernt, was Lowcode und Mendix-Plattformkomponenten sind. In diesem Artikel erfahren wir, wie Sie mit der Entwicklung von Mendix-Apps beginnen, den Modeler installieren und seine Panels, Menüpunkte usw. kennenlernen,
Bei der App-Modellierung geht es um die Erstellung und Konfiguration einer App, z. B. die Erstellung von Seiten, das Hinzufügen von Daten und Logik, die Konfiguration der Sicherheit und die Integration mit anderen Anwendungen.
Mit Mendix Studio Pro können Sie Ihre Mendix-Anwendungen erstellen, bearbeiten und anzeigen. Mit Mendix Studio (Web-Version) können Sie in gewissem Umfang auch Anwendungen entwickeln, aber Studio Pro bietet mehr Flexibilität.
Sie können Mendix studio herunterladen. In diesem App Store finden Sie auch Add-ons und Konnektoren.
Mendix Modellierer
Sobald wir den Mendix Modeler öffnen, zeigt der Projekt-Explorer (siehe unten) die Informationen zur Strukturierung des Projekts, einschließlich wichtiger Details zur Sicherheit und Navigation.
Um eine Anwendung zu entwerfen, müssen wir die folgenden Phasen durchlaufen:
- Domänenmodell- enthält Informationen zur Erstellung und Pflege des Datenmodells für Ihre Anwendung.
- Seiten- enthält Informationen zum Erstellen und Konfigurieren von Seiten sowie zu den verschiedenen Elementen auf diesen Seiten. Sie können vorgefertigte UI-Widgets, Bausteine und Layouts nutzen.
- Anwendungslogik- enthält Einzelheiten zur Verwendung und Konfiguration von Mikro- und Nanoabläufen: Elemente, die Ihrer Anwendung Logik hinzufügen.
- Ressourcen- stellt verschiedene individuelle Ressourcen (Dokumente) vor, die Sie in Ihrer Anwendung verwenden können, z. B. Java-Aktionen, Aufzählungen, geplante Ereignisse
- Integration- Details zu Methoden der Integration mit Mendix- und Nicht-Mendix-Anwendungen
- XPath- führt Sie in die Mendix-Abfragesprache ein, einschließlich Details zu XPath-Beschränkungen, -Funktionen und -Tokens.
Unser Ausgangspunkt ist der Projekt-Explorer, also lassen Sie uns in diesen eintauchen
Menüpunkte auf der obersten Ebene sind hilfreich beim Erstellen, Importieren/Exportieren von mpk (mendix pkg), beim Abstimmen der Layouts und bei der Markierung der ausklappbaren Fensterbereiche.
Das Projektmenü hilft bei der Synchronisierung mit der Verzeichnisstruktur des Backend-Projekts, beim Erstellen von Deployment-Paketen und beim Erstellen von Paketen für Eclipse (für die Java-Entwicklung).
Das Menü Ausführen hilft Ihnen bei der Einstellung der Konfiguration, der Protokollstufen, der Cloud-Konfiguration und der Fehlersuche.
Das Menü Versionskontrolle hilft bei der Verwaltung (Upload/Download) von Quellen aus der Versionskontrolle, der Verwaltung und Zusammenführung von Zweigen. Es hilft auch bei der Anzeige Ihrer Änderungen vor dem Übertragen/Zusammenführen.
Mit dem Menü Sprache können Sie zusätzliche Sprachen und Übersetzungen für Ihre App verwalten. Dazu gehören Funktionen, die Ihnen helfen, einen Text an allen Stellen, an denen er vorkommt, mit einer einzigen Änderung zu übersetzen, anstatt jedes Vorkommen einzeln variieren zu müssen.
Im Menü Hilfe finden Sie die Dokumentation und können den Ordner Logs durchsuchen.
Ausführen und ansehen
Diese Menüs im oberen Zentrum helfen Ihnen, Ihre Änderungen lokal / in der Cloud durchzuführen. Mit Hilfe des Ansicht-Menüs können Sie die App in responsiver / Tablet / mobiler Auflösung zum Testen anzeigen.
Projekt Dashboard, App Store und Profil
Über diesen Menüpunkt oben rechts können Sie den App Store, das Entwicklerportal und die von Ihnen erstellten Apps erkunden. Das Chat-Symbol öffnet das Projekt-Dashboard in der Cloud.
Projekt Dashboard
AppStore
Gemeinschaft
Zertifizierung / Akademie
Nun, da wir wissen, wie man den Mendix Modeler installiert, den Projekt-Explorer und andere Panels nutzt, ist es an der Zeit, sich die Hände schmutzig zu machen und eine App zu erstellen, indem wir die wichtigen Phasen durchlaufen (Domain-Modell, Seiten, App-Logik usw.). Bleiben Sie dran!
Verfasst von
Ganesh
Engineering Manager at coMakeIT
Unsere Ideen
Weitere Blogs
Contact



